Abstract
Mobile applications are subject to frequent updates, which poses a challenge for validating digital forensic tools. This paper presents an approach to automate the generation of reference data on an ongoing basis, and how this can be integrated into the overall validation process of a digital forensic analysis platform. Specifically, it describes the architecture of the mobile data synthesis framework Puma, shares its capabilities via an open-source project, and shows how it can be used in a tool testing workflow triggered by application updates. The value of this approach is demonstrated with three example use cases, documenting the use of the approach over six months and reporting insights and experiences gained from this integration. Finally, this work highlights additional contributions the proposed approach and tooling could make to the digital forensics community.
